V2Ray是一款功能强大的网络代理工具,广泛应用于科学上网和隐私保护中。本文将深入探讨如何通过v2ray-install.ml进行V2Ray的安装和配置,帮助用户轻松上手。
什么是v2ray-install.ml?
v2ray-install.ml是一个在线脚本,旨在简化V2Ray的安装过程。用户只需执行几个简单的命令,就能完成V2Ray的安装,配置和优化。此脚本为希望使用V2Ray的用户提供了极大的便利。
V2Ray的主要功能
V2Ray具备多种功能,主要包括:
- 多协议支持:支持VMess、Shadowsocks、SOCKS等多种协议。
- 动态端口:可以配置动态端口,增强隐蔽性。
- 路由功能:可以根据不同的规则选择不同的路由。
- 流量混淆:通过混淆流量来避免被流量监控。
V2Ray的安装步骤
以下是通过v2ray-install.ml安装V2Ray的详细步骤:
1. 准备工作
在安装V2Ray之前,确保你的服务器满足以下要求:
- 一台可用的VPS(如DigitalOcean、Vultr等)。
- 具备SSH访问权限。
- 操作系统为CentOS、Ubuntu等常见Linux发行版。
2. SSH登录
使用SSH工具(如PuTTY或终端)登录到你的VPS。命令格式如下:
ssh root@your_server_ip
3. 下载并执行安装脚本
在SSH终端中输入以下命令下载并执行v2ray-install.ml的安装脚本:
curl -O https://v2ray-install.ml/install.sh bash install.sh
4. 配置V2Ray
安装完成后,你需要配置V2Ray。配置文件一般位于/etc/v2ray/config.json
。你可以使用文本编辑器(如nano或vim)打开并编辑此文件,修改代理服务器、端口及用户ID等信息。
5. 启动V2Ray
完成配置后,启动V2Ray服务:
systemctl start v2ray
6. 验证安装
使用以下命令检查V2Ray的状态,确保其正常运行:
systemctl status v2ray
V2Ray的常见配置
1. 设置UUID
在config.json
文件中,你需要为每个用户设置一个UUID(通用唯一标识符),可通过以下命令生成:
cat /proc/sys/kernel/random/uuid
2. 选择协议
在配置文件中,可以选择不同的传输协议,根据需要选择合适的配置:
- VMess:V2Ray的默认协议,适合大多数场景。
- Shadowsocks:在某些网络环境下更易被接受。
3. 自定义路由规则
根据需求添加自定义路由规则,以便优化流量。可在配置文件中的routing
部分进行设置。
常见问题解答(FAQ)
Q1: v2ray-install.ml的脚本安全吗?
A: v2ray-install.ml提供的脚本经过社区用户测试,安全性较高。建议在官方论坛或社区中查看反馈。
Q2: V2Ray是否能用在Windows上?
A: 是的,V2Ray不仅支持Linux,还支持Windows和macOS用户,用户可以根据系统选择合适的客户端。
Q3: 如何更新V2Ray?
A: 更新V2Ray可以重新运行安装脚本,系统会自动检测并更新到最新版本。
Q4: V2Ray可以同时支持多个用户吗?
A: 可以,通过在配置文件中添加多个用户的UUID来实现。
Q5: 使用V2Ray需要备案吗?
A: 根据中国的网络规定,使用V2Ray进行翻墙可能需要备案,请根据当地法律法规使用。
结论
通过使用v2ray-install.ml,用户可以轻松完成V2Ray的安装和配置。V2Ray强大的功能和灵活的配置选项,使其成为网络安全与隐私保护的理想选择。希望本指南能帮助用户顺利安装和使用V2Ray,实现科学上网的目的。